Hub airports are recording average layover extensions of 45-90 minutes as security processing and slot limitations tighten schedules. Those added dwell windows enable sleep-pod operators to generate higher revenue per square meter than many retail concepts. As airlines concentrate long-haul flows into fewer banks, demand spikes align with pod availability, prompting terminal redesigns that position pods near under-utilized gate clusters. Airports in the Middle East, Asia, and North America increasingly view pods as anchor tenants in "dwell-time monetization" zones that also improve passenger satisfaction.
More than 70% of flyers under 35 show strong interest in sleep pods versus 40% for conventional shopping offers, marking a structural redirect of on-premise spending. Experiential allocations already average 11% of total discretionary outlays for these cohorts, and Asia-Pacific business-travel surveys register a willingness to pay premiums that secure productivity during transits. Airlines are reinforcing the trend - Air New Zealand's economy-class bunk concept mirrors the expectation that rest options exist across the journey. Because these travelers wield high lifetime value and social-media influence, airports integrating pods benefit from amplified digital word-of-mouth.
Sleeping pods demand dedicated ventilation, electrical, and security integrations that can elevate per-square-meter installation costs above USD 50,000 in retrofit environments. European airports are already short on leasable area; therefore, pods should be weighed against duty-free outlets offering guaranteed minimum rents. Modular pod designs and plug-and-play utility couplings are closing the cost gap, yet real-estate committees still require compelling density metrics before greenlighting deployments in premium concourses.

Single units secured 65.62% of the airport sleeping pods market in 2025 as business travelers prioritized exclusive space and hygiene assurance at Abu Dhabi International's AED 45-per-hour suites. The airport sleeping pods market size for single units equated to roughly USD 53.7 million that year. Early post-pandemic sentiment and laptop-friendly work surfaces amplify willingness to pay, cementing individual capsules as the premium benchmark.
Shared configurations are advancing at an 8.62% CAGR through 2031, reflecting price-sensitive leisure traffic and families pursuing affordable respite. For example, operators in Japan's Narita Terminal allocate female-only corridors to preserve privacy while improving density. These mixed-use formats expand the total addressable audience yet require stringent occupancy-mix algorithms to avoid over-booking or low-turnover drift. The segment's airport sleeping pods market size is projected to almost double by 2031, diversifying revenue streams for facility managers.
Standard stays spanning two to six hours dominated with a 49.78% market share in 2025, capturing predictable transfer windows that allow airports to rotate pods four or five times per day. Because cleaning can be batched between waves, operating margins remain attractive even at moderate hourly rates. Overnight bookings past six hours, while smaller in volume, expand at a 7.79% CAGR as flight disruptions and red-eye scheduling proliferate, especially across intercontinental routes from Europe to Asia-Pacific.
The longer-stay cohort materially lifts revenue per transaction: at Helsinki Airport, average receipts on overnight sessions exceed daytime naps by 60%. Airports accordingly experiment with bundled shower and locker add-ons to drive ancillary spend. Sub-2-hour "power naps" fill trough periods yet rarely exceed 15% of bookings, limiting their overall impact on the airport sleeping pods market.
North America's 37.92% revenue lead is anchored by robust business-travel recovery and sophisticated concession partnerships that bundle pods with credit-card lounge access. Minute Suites' forthcoming rollout at JFK Terminal 4 exemplifies this synergy, enabling travelers to book through mobile apps and loyalty programs in tandem. Regulatory initiatives such as the FAA's technology-research funds lower adoption risk by offsetting innovation expenses and encouraging integrations like biometric access.
Asia-Pacific's 8.69% CAGR to 2031 underscores rapid terminal modernization and growing long-haul connectivity that elevate layover lengths. Singapore, South Korea, and India governments provide capital incentives for passenger-experience features, while regional carriers position rest amenities as key differentiators in fare classes. The region's advanced IoT adoption accelerates the deployment of sensor-rich pods capable of predictive maintenance and energy optimization, improving uptime and lowering lifecycle costs.
Europe balances real-estate scarcity with intense competition among hubs for international transfer traffic. Heathrow's recently unveiled Ultra Pods integrate advanced HVAC, circadian lighting, and real-time occupancy updates, aligning with continent-wide sustainability directives. Airports use granular utilization data to demonstrate revenue density superior to luxury-retail tenants, supporting continued pod footprint expansion despite space constraints.
